PHOTOS: Mrs. Lambert's Retirement Party
Arlean Lambert retires after 24 years as Marshall School's librarian.
Arlean Lambert was feted with an afternoon tea on Friday at Marshall School. Over the past 24 years, Lambert has turned the library into an enchanting Secret Garden for generations of students through hard work, humor and creative intuition about what works. She has inspired Pennies for Peace and TV turnoff programs, with the overriding message to read. The party was highlighted by kind words by parents and former students, and the composition of a song sung by the children: "A Garden of Stories."
Photos were taken by Holly Joyce Lehren, a sixth grader at South Orange Middle School.
